Majority of people have already received their stimulus checks in the summer, but there is a vast amount of people who have yet to see anything from the IRS. This due to the fact that the IRS may not have the correct address or some other mailing problem causes the check to return to IRS. When this happens the check then becomes unclaimed. Currently there is no clear vision as to what will happen next, but various ideas bounced by the IRS suggest that these unclaimed checks will be applied as a tax refund for the following year. When looking at a state of Illinois we found that more then $5 million dollars have been returned to the IRS due to the mailing problems. In addition some families and individuals who qualify for tax refunds will not be getting their refund any time soon due to again mailing problems. The amount of these refunds is close $3.5 million.

Address Change
I have moved since filing my 2007 tax return. How will my payment reach me?
A. Filing Form 8822, Change of Address, with the IRS and a change of address notice with the U.S. Postal Service will help ensure that any mail from the IRS, including your stimulus payment check, is sent to your new address. If the check has already been mailed and you did not provide the IRS with an updated address, the check will most likely be returned to the IRS. You may call the IRS at 1-866-234-2942 to provide your new address so that steps can be taken to have the check reissued.

Charlotte Area News, N.C. reports “There's $163 million in economic stimulus money still out there waiting to be delivered. Thousands of checks have been returned to the IRS because of incorrect addresses, and if you haven't gotten yours yet, you're running out of time.”
Unclaimed money from generated by the stimulus checks has been on a steady rise. The IRS is facing many problems that are revealing on their own. For one there IRS has many “glitches” resulting in incorrect mailing addresses, how can this be? They never seem to forget my address when they need money from me? More then 270,000 stimulus checks have been returned due to incorrect address in N.C alone.
Not all is lost, by law if the checks are not mailed by the end of the year, then the money will be applied towards a tax credit for the following’s year taxes.
